  • Korea Rural Development Administration is discussing terminology unification with related organizations to correct the misuse of "acacia honey" to the correct term, "acacia honey."
  • Acacia and acacia trees belong to the same Rosaceae legume family but have different scientific names, characteristics, etc.
  • The term "acacia" was solidified after large-scale forest reforestation post-Korean War, dropping the "pseudo" part.
  • Import of Vietnamese acacia honey after the Korea-Vietnam Free Trade Agreement in 2015 created confusion among consumers.
  • Nongjin Agency plans to promote domestic acacia honey to prevent harm to beekeepers.
  • Domestic acacia honey, comprising 70% of Korea's honey production, has health benefits like quick absorption and fatigue relief.
  • Studies show domestic acacia honey inhibits Helicobacter pylori bacteria, associated with gastritis, ulcers, and stomach cancer.
  • Dr. Lee Sang-jae from the Korea Agriculture Research Institute emphasizes providing accurate information about acacia honey.
